808-RO55 Void Shield Generator

The 808-RO55 (erroneously but commonly pronounced eight-oh-eight, are-zero-fifty-five) "happy little" void shield generator provides planetary defense on Ophelia VII. A relatively recently discovered STC design blessed by the Ecclesiarchy, they are powerful techno-sacramentals most frequently used to defend the 'Dust Zone and the Via Imperator, although examples of them are found elsewhere on Ophelia VII, lesser planets of the Ophelia System and even other Cardinal worlds.  

History

  The basic design of the 808-RO55 generator was discovered by an Adeptus Mechanicus explorator fleet during the Age of Apostasy. Assigned a long identity number which ended in 808 by the tech-priests, the design utilized a unique reciprocating oscillation of the shield harmonics at a 55hz frequency - leading to its common name among those working on integrating it with the Imperium's ritualized-technology. This design, if it could be understood and perfected, promised to produce effective void shielding with low power requirements and minimal cycle time.   However, the STC blueprints were incomplete and corrupted, and a functional prototype eluded the Mechanicus. One of the most significant problems was discordant harmonics set up by the reciprocating oscillation, which not only rendered the void shield weak and prone to fracture, but also seemed to cause emotional and physiological impairment in organic humans under the shield. This depression and loss of bowel-control were dismissed as anecdotal and unconnected until controlled experimentation by a pair of Magos-Biologics empirically verified the generator as the causal factor. The specific conditions were named after them (Pthalo Blues and Van-Dyke Browns).   As the Age of Apostasy drew to a close, the Mechanicus were no closer to cracking the secrets of the 808-RO55 generator. It was only when agreements were brokered between Mars and the Ecclesiarchy to provide the Sisters of Battle with arms and armor and the 'Dust Zone was given to the Mechanicus that a breakthrough was made. Elsewhere on Ophelia VII earlier void shield designs had been used, but to protect the Mechanicus' home-base on the planet the potential of the 808-RO55 generator could not be overlooked. The Magi returned to the designs, invigorated by the problem but also inspired by new information they discovered on the Cardinal world.   Ancient vid-logs of techno-philosophy from a saint of the Imperial cult pushed their thoughts in a different direction - by incorporating one of his fundamental principles ("thin will stick to thick") they were able to resolve the disharmonic issue, resulting in not only an elimination of Pthalo Greens and Van-Dyke Browns, but also the creation of two nested void shields from each generator. This unforeseen development was initially viewed with grave suspicion by the ultra-traditional Mechanicus, until further studies of the vid-logs revealed "everyone needs a friend".   This was taken as not only vindication of the second shield, but an omen the secrets of the STC would be revealed by this saint's teachings. Full-power tests of the generator revealed not only did it not cause negative emotional issues now the harmonics were aligned, but that a feeling of mild euphoria was created in those under its aegis. Higher power levels caused manic and even foolhardy behavior, dryly recorded as "happy little accidents" in the Mechanicus' logs. Development and tests continued.   Eventually, a prototype 808-RO55 generator was field-tested in the 'Dust Zone, observed by senior Ecclesiarchy clerics. The test was successful - the device itself was smaller than comparable generators and the nested shields capable of being deployed faster than by other methods. The archimandrite of the monastery devoted to the saint whose techno-philosophy had provided the breakthrough was pleased with the device's practical application, but felt that it could be more effective against the Ruinous Powers. Accepting there were things beyond their science, the Adeptus Mechanicus allowed the monks access to the generator.   The monks blessed the generator, anointing it with odorless solvents and daubing it with sacred pigments (the names of which they ran across the bottom of the control terminal screen when the generator was powered on). The result was that individuals possessed by malignant Warp entities under the aegis of the shield reacted as if being struck blows and were frequently exorcised. The Adeptus Mechanicus were at a loss to explain this, but the archimandrite understood it perfectly. "Truly," he reminded them, "did the holy one not say he would 'beat the devil out of it'?"   After these successful field tests, 808-RO55 generators - colloquially known as "happy little" void shield generators because of the euphoric effect and their small size - were installed to provide protection to the 'Dust Zone and also to replace defective or damaged generators elsewhere on Ophelia VII. When the Daughters of Verity took over the Via Imperator, large numbers of 808-RO55 generators were installed to protect their cloister fortress.

Utility

Provides two nested void shields which are particularly efficacious against Warp-incursion from a smaller device and with a shorter start-up time than comparable generators.

Access & Availability
Deployed only on Ecclesiarchy-controlled planets; its operation is only understood by the Adeptus Mechanicus of the 'Dust Zone and requires the spiritual attentions of a sub-cult of the Ecclesiarchy devoted to a particular saint of the Imperial Cult.
Complexity
Highly complex technology; it is speculated by techno-theologians (such as the Machaenices Canonical of the Daughters of Verity) that the device is a techno-sacramental and requires spiritual energy from specific worship rituals of the God-Emperor to function correctly.
